Basically we can replace quite a few unused system plugins with xai type plugins very easily, I have tested this by running 3 variations of the xai plugin on my console at once.
All you need to do is rename the xai plugins to any one of these:
- strviewer_plugin.sprx
- hknw_plugin.sprx
- edy_plugin.sprx
- wboard_plugin.sprx
- bdp_plugin.sprx
- friendim_plugin.sprx
- sacd_plugin.sprx
- kensaku_plugin.sprx
- etc, Im sure there are more. Only tested these few.
Code:
<Pair key="icon_rsc"><String>item_tex_ms_icon</String></Pair>
<Pair key="title"><String>Enable dev_blind</String></Pair>
<Pair key="module_name"><String>hknw_plugin</String></Pair>
<Pair key="module_action"><String>enable_devblind</String></Pair>
<Pair key="bar_action"><String>none</String></Pair>
<Pair key="lbl_half"><String>1</String></Pair>
Anyway, thats it. Some of those plugins are not needed on 99.9% of consoles such as
strviewer, sacd, kensaku, hknw, and edy plugin, so these are good candidates for replacement.
Note: Strviewer_plugin seems to have issues with actions other than reboots, it
doesn't crash the console, but it kind of hangs on moving wave after performing the
action, the other plugins all work perfectly as xai replacements.
